Medical Illustration & Informatics is the 193rd most popular major in the country with 2,089 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, medical illustration and informatics gra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$70,135 and had an average of $32,175 in loans still to pay off.

Across the Southeast region, there were 567 medical illustration and informatics graduates with average earnings and debt of $73,788 and $0 respectively.

This year’s “Most Veteran Friendly in the Southeast Region for Medical Illustration for a Master’s” ranking looked at 18 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in medical illustration and informatics.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ality medical illustration and informatics programs as well as strong veteran support.

When determining these rankings, we looked at things such as overall quality of the medical illustration and informatics program at the school, veteran affordability, and veteran satisfaction. Check out our ranking methodology for more information.
